April 24, 2026 🚀 NexClip AI is now on the Mac App Store — 14 years in the making

Today I shipped NexClip AI on the Mac App Store! 🎉

10 days ago, I launched the Paddle (direct download) version on Product Hunt. Today the Mac App Store version is also live — completing the launch.

This is the product I've been trying to build since 2012. 14 years of attempts, failures, and pivots.

The 14-year journey:

🎬 2012: Started editing video professionally and kept hitting the same wall — no prosumer media asset management tools existed.

🛠️ 2012-2018: Tried to build the solution myself. Six years on ffmpeg + PostgreSQL. Hit the limits of what one person could build alone.

🏢 2019: Founded Cyberseeds to carry the work forward.

💔 2024: Shipped MediaQue v1. Wrong direction. Few users. Pulled it later.

Early 2025: Started using Claude Code. The velocity of what one person could build shifted fundamentally. Work that would've taken 5 more years took 12 months.

📱 April 14, 2026: Paddle version + Product Hunt launch.

🚀 April 24, 2026 (today): Mac App Store version is live.

Tech stack:

- Swift (SwiftUI) + Rust (7 crates, 70+ FFI functions via UniFFI)

- ElevenLabs Scribe v2 for transcription

- Vibrato for native Japanese NLP (not machine-translated)

- Patent pending (US Provisional filed Dec 29, 2025)

- Native Mac, not Electron

Distribution strategy:

- Mac App Store: Apple takes 30%/15%, but trusted + discovery

- Direct from nexclipai.com (Paddle as Merchant of Record): ~5% fees

- Credit packs available via Apple IAP or Paddle billing

Pricing:

- Free: 45 credits/month (no credit card required)

- Creator: $12.50/mo annual, 450 credits

- Pro: $20.83/mo annual, 1,200 credits

- 1 credit = 1 minute of video processed

April 14, 2026 🚀 NexClip AI is live on Product Hunt today!

I'm a solo founder with 25 years in video production. Built NexClip AI because every AI clipping tool decides what's "interesting" — but nobody asks what's relevant. NexClip extracts topics from your video/audio, you pick what matters, edit subclips, export with subtitles or to your NLE. macOS native. Swift + Rust. Patent pending.
